Hello @dqlproperty 

 

I definitely recommend putting in a support bracket where the two shelves meet. This will prevent it from sagging or bending out of shape should weight be applied to it for an extended period of time. I've drawn up a sample image just to give you an idea of how it can be done, please note that the measurements are for reference only, please adjust them to your needs.
